About the Artist
Babymetal burst onto the scene in 2010 as a sub-unit of the Japanese idol group Sakura Gakuin. What began as an experimental concept β blending idol pop with extreme metal β quickly evolved into a global sensation. Their debut album, "Babymetal," released in 2014, garnered international acclaim, propelled by viral hits like "Gimme Chocolate!!" Their music is characterised by catchy melodies, upbeat J-pop arrangements, and surprisingly heavy guitar riffs, often drawing comparisons to thrash and speed metal. The visual aspect is equally important, with the trio performing in elaborate costumes and executing precise, synchronised dance routines, creating a striking contrast with the aggressive musical backdrop.
Over the years, Babymetal has toured extensively, sharing stages with some of metal's biggest names and headlining major festivals. Their live shows are renowned for their professionalism, theatricality, and the sheer energy they bring to the stage. The "Kami Band," a group of highly skilled musicians, provides the thunderous instrumental foundation, allowing Su-metal and Moametal to deliver their powerful vocals and captivating stage presence. Their journey from a niche concept to a globally recognised act is a testament to their unique artistry and the universal appeal of their genre-bending sound. They have released several successful albums, including "Metal Resistance," "Metal Galaxy," and "The Other One," each pushing their creative boundaries while staying true to their core identity.
The Venue
The Cynthia Woods Mitchell Pavilion, located in The Woodlands, Texas, is a premier outdoor amphitheatre renowned for hosting a diverse range of musical acts and cultural events. Situated just north of Houston, this state-of-the-art venue offers a fantastic setting for live performances, with seating capacities that can accommodate thousands of fans. Known for its excellent acoustics and picturesque surroundings, the Pavilion provides an intimate yet grand atmosphere for concert-goers. Whether you're seated in the reserved sections or enjoying the expansive lawn area, the views of the stage are generally superb, enhanced by the natural beauty of the surrounding trees. The venue boasts modern amenities, including ample restrooms, concession stands offering a variety of food and beverages, and convenient parking facilities, ensuring a comfortable and enjoyable experience for all attendees.
